What it does
Tracktion allows an artist to upload an song of their choice. Our tool listens to the song and analyzes the semantics and motifs about the audio, and synthesizes it into text form. Then, we have a series of agentic AI chatbots to simulate online discourse about that song before it's released.
We then run sentiment analysis on these conversations to assess if the tone is positive, negative, or mixed overall. The result demonstrates potential public reception to the artist, giving artists early insight to how their work will be received.

How we built it
Webscraped 2,000+ YouTube clips from a public dataset and did transfer learning on a 286 million parameter multi-modal OpenAI audio analysis model called Whisper-small.
Utilized Gemini API to simulate tweets with prompt engineering.
Used a pre-trained sentiment analysis model from HuggingFace trained on 124 million tweets from January 2018 to December 2021 to determine and visualize the overall trend in agentic responses to the audio file.
